Results in Euless, The Colony, Rockwall, Argyle, Mesquite, Cypress, Keller, Grapevine and Addison

Showing 12 of 137 results
Papa John's Pizza
Papa John's Pizza
940 Keller Pkwy Suite 280, Keller, Texas 76248, United States
1 2 3 4 5